🔀 Merge pull request #1423 from stinkybernie/update-simple-icons

Update 'simple-icons' from v7.19.0 to v10.4.0
Fixes #1254
This commit is contained in:
Alicia Sykes 2024-04-29 01:14:24 +01:00 committed by GitHub
commit 5854db4205
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
2 changed files with 5 additions and 4 deletions

View File

@ -33,8 +33,8 @@
"register-service-worker": "^1.7.2", "register-service-worker": "^1.7.2",
"remedial": "^1.0.8", "remedial": "^1.0.8",
"rss-parser": "3.13.0", "rss-parser": "3.13.0",
"simple-icons": "^10.4.0",
"rsup-progress": "^3.2.0", "rsup-progress": "^3.2.0",
"simple-icons": "^7.19.0",
"v-jsoneditor": "^1.4.5", "v-jsoneditor": "^1.4.5",
"v-tooltip": "^2.1.3", "v-tooltip": "^2.1.3",
"vue": "^2.7.0", "vue": "^2.7.0",

View File

@ -21,7 +21,6 @@
</template> </template>
<script> <script>
import simpleIcons from 'simple-icons';
import BrokenImage from '@/assets/interface-icons/broken-icon.svg'; import BrokenImage from '@/assets/interface-icons/broken-icon.svg';
import ErrorHandler from '@/utils/ErrorHandler'; import ErrorHandler from '@/utils/ErrorHandler';
import EmojiUnicodeRegex from '@/utils/EmojiUnicodeRegex'; import EmojiUnicodeRegex from '@/utils/EmojiUnicodeRegex';
@ -29,6 +28,8 @@ import emojiLookup from '@/utils/emojis.json';
import { asciiHash } from '@/utils/MiscHelpers'; import { asciiHash } from '@/utils/MiscHelpers';
import { faviconApi as defaultFaviconApi, faviconApiEndpoints, iconCdns } from '@/utils/defaults'; import { faviconApi as defaultFaviconApi, faviconApiEndpoints, iconCdns } from '@/utils/defaults';
const simpleicons = require('simple-icons');
export default { export default {
name: 'Icon', name: 'Icon',
props: { props: {
@ -186,8 +187,8 @@ export default {
}, },
/* Returns the SVG path content */ /* Returns the SVG path content */
getSimpleIcon(img) { getSimpleIcon(img) {
const imageName = img.replace('si-', ''); const imageName = img.charAt(3).toUpperCase() + img.slice(4);
const icon = simpleIcons.Get(imageName); const icon = simpleicons[`si${imageName}`];
if (!icon) { if (!icon) {
this.imageNotFound(`No icon was found for '${imageName}' in Simple Icons`); this.imageNotFound(`No icon was found for '${imageName}' in Simple Icons`);
return null; return null;